**NDT Technician**

Employer: LMATS Pty Ltd

Position Location: Perth

Position Tenancy: Full-time, permanent

**Salary**: $90000-$105000 dependant on skills and experience

**Who we are**:
**What we seek**:
**LMATS **is seeking **NDT Technician** for Perth office located in Bibra Lake.

Reporting to state manager, NDT Technician will be responsible for designing and preparing range of onsite and laboratory-based testing services to determine the test arrangements and test loads in accordance with the NATA’s requirements.

**Responsibilities include but are not limited to**:

- Determine test arrangements and test loads in accordance with client’s requirements.
- Select test methods to be used, organize required equipment for the relevant tests
- Perform mechanical and metallurgical testing in accordance with LMATS procedures and NATA requirements.
- Responsible for all the equipment in the laboratory, their maintenance, and calibration
- Undertake site inspections and liaise with clients to understand their test requirements.
- Review test failure data, conduct various tests to establish possible causes and recommend suitable solution.
- Preparation of technical reports documenting the outcome of the tests.

**To be successful in this role, you’ll need the following skills and knowledge**:

- Material properties, electronic principles, mathematics and technical project management
- Advanced NDT, condition monitoring, structural health monitoring and quality management
- Commercial awareness and the economics of their industry sector, business improvement and project and business management techniques relevant to the engineering industry
- Regulatory and international standards requirements, technology, safety and the environment
- The interaction between NDT and other engineering functions, the consequences of failure and the contribution of NDT to asset management and life extension
- Root cause analysis and learning from experience (LFE) processes

**Essential Attributes & Qualifications**
- Relevant AINDT certificates or ability to obtain (UT/MT/RT/PT Level 2 ISO 9712)
- At least 2 years of relevant work experience as an NDT Technician
- Computer literate - Technical report writing
- Excellent English communication
- Willing to travel locally and regionally to complete jobs at client sites
- driving license - Manual C - Class

This position is for an applicant having a positive attitude for a continuous professional development. **LMATS **comprises a highly experienced team of Metallurgist, Engineers, Inspectors, Engineering Technologists and Engineering technicians. The combination of these professionals from different speciality area provides opportunities for employees to gain rapid industry experience.
